Lodges & sleeping surfaces
Comfortable rest starts with the right floor: anti-slip rubber mats, soft surfaces and optimized bedding materials reduce joint stress and promote better posture. When cows lie down and get up more easily, production losses decrease and udder life is protected.
Brushes & refreshments
Cows love to pass under a oscillating brush, which removes dirt and insects, stimulates blood circulation and helps maintain ideal body temperature. These natural actions improve overall comfort and allow animals to devote their energy to lactation rather than to managing their environment.
Watering
Consistent access to fresh, clean, and sufficient water is essential for health and milk production. Our drinking solutions guarantee continuous distribution, encouraging regular intakes and reducing the risk of dehydration, especially in changing weather conditions.

The OptiDuo™ robot doesn't just push the ration back: it automatically mixes and repositions it, which encourages cows to feed more frequently and improves the quality consistency of the ration. The result: more milk produced per cow, less waste, and a reduction in labor of up to $3,500 per year.
DelPro FarmManager allows you to plan and execute a rational strategy for each cow or group, based on the lactation stage (DIM), production level, or days before calving (DTC). You can program smooth transitions between two types of food or schedule a ration supplement at the peak of lactation, all with assignments that automatically follow one another without interruption.
Both systems offer the same benefits in terms of milking, animal comfort and efficiency. The VMS™ V310 also includes RePro™ technology, which measures progesterone levels in milk to automatically track ovulation, pregnancy, or reproductive disorders.
The VMS™ (Voluntary Milking System) is an autonomous milking robot that allows cows to be milked when they want, without human intervention. It improves animal health, reduces workload, and automatically collects accurate data on each milking.
